noelinevc, Jan 25, 11:48am
I use this
2 Tablespoons Paprika
2 Tablespoons Salt
3 Tablespoons White Sugar
2 Tablespoons Brown Sugar
1 Tablespoon Ground Cumin
2 Teaspoons Chili Powder
1 Tablespoon Freshly Ground Black Pepper
1 Tablespoon Onion Powder
1 Tablespoon Garlic Powder
1 Tablespoon Celery Salt
1 Teaspoon Oregano-crushed
1/2 Teaspoon Cayenne Pepper (opptional)

If I wanted nuts I would add about 5 Tablespoons of chopped pistachios
